latex子图标题居中
时间: 2024-12-28 20:41:13 浏览: 8
在 LaTeX 中,如果你想要子图的标题居中对齐,可以使用 `subcaption` 包或者直接在 `\includegraphics` 后面添加自定义命令。以下是两个例子:
1. 如果你在使用 `subcaption` 包,并且使用了 `subfigure` 或 `subfloat` 环境,可以这样做:
```latex
\begin{figure}
\centering
\subfloat[子图标题]{\label{fig:sub1}\includegraphics[width=0.45\textwidth]{image1}}
\hfill
\subfloat[另一个子图标题]{\label{fig:sub2}\includegraphics[width=0.45\textwidth]{image2}}
\caption{主图标题}
\label{fig:main}
\end{figure}
```
这里,`subfloat` 的每个参数都会自动设置标题居中。
2. 如果你想通过自定义命令来控制标题样式,你可以创建一个宏,比如:
```latex
\newcommand{\centeredfigcaption}[2]{%
\captionsetup{labelformat=empty, textfont=center}%
\caption[#1]{#2}%
}
```
然后在图片后面加上这个命令:
```latex
\centeredfigcaption{子图标题}{\includegraphics[width=0.45\textwidth]{image1}}
```
这样标题就会居中显示。
阅读全文